 This cache was inspired by the cookies that Lvb gave out at a noco geo night event....the cans make a great cache container. I thought it would be fun to start a series that any of my friends that attended that night could add onto if they chose to. I named mine using my favorite flavor and then my caching name. I did not cover it with camo because I thought seeing the cookie can itself would be a fun reminder of a great event.
